East Battenfield, Lansing, MI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Battenfield?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| East Battenfield Studio Apartments | $855 | $675 | $1,025 |
| East Battenfield 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,093 | $715 | $1,850 |
| East Battenfield 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,283 | $800 | $2,315 |
| East Battenfield 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,561 | $1,250 | $2,710 |
| East Battenfield 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,604 | $1,575 | $1,825 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included East Battenfield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included East Battenfield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in East Battenfield is $1,008.
What is the largest Utilities Included East Battenfield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in East Battenfield is a 1,344 square feet unit starting from $1,399 at Oakbrook Townhomes.
What is the average size for East Battenfield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in East Battenfield is currently at 629 sq ft.
